AOL acquires Mailblocks anti-spam service

Thursday, 5 August 2004, 10:22 AM EST

America Online said Wednesday it has acquired Mailblocks, which develops challenge-and-response technology to fight unwanted junk e-mail and authenticate e-mail senders.

Terms were not disclosed. Mailblocks, a privately held firm based in Los Altos, California, was founded in 2002 by the late Phil Goldman and was launched in March 2003 as an e-mail service for home users andsmall businesses.
